PRESS RELEASE - Jan 15 - Crazy Blind Date (CBD) uses math to set singles up on blind dates with a few hours notice. “People will say that CBD is too crazy,” said Sam Yagan, OkCupid Co-Founder (CEO Match.com), “But for a whole generation of young singles, it’s going to be a great adventure, and a great complement to traditional online dating.”
Users choose which nights to go on dates. Pick their favorite bar/coffee shop. CBD does the rest and sends a confirmation to both parties. One hour before the scheduled date users can anonymously IM, so they can find each other. After the date ends, CBD collects feedback. Users can vouch for their date by purchasing CBD “Kudos” for them. This incentivizes good behavior. The more Kudos daters collect, the more dates they get.
“Never before has a dating app allowed singles to pay on a per-date basis, and to vary that payment based on the quality of the date itself,” continued Yagan.
To celebrate the launch of CBD, OkCupid, has named today, “LOVE IS BLIND” day. Every one of the ten million photos on OkCupid has been removed from the site. Today they'll make their dating decisions based on words and wits alone. (CBD was designed in collaboration with Huge).
